Reducing Food Waste
BA Class of 2026, Capstone Project
In their Capstone class, seniors of DRBU’s Bachelor of Arts in Liberal Arts program pursue topics and projects tailored to their interests and circumstances. This class challenges students to apply their education to real-world problems and explore how their learning can provide a foundation for life after DRBU.
This year’s seniors chose to research the impact of food waste and how we can work to reduce it. We are thrilled to share their findings and recommendations.
